21. Once all fasteners have been started, torque the rear bracket bolts to 102 ft-lbs. The
½”
fasteners can be torqued to 102 ft-lbs. The cab isolator fasteners can be torqued to 240 ft-lbs.
22. Remove the chain or lifting strap from the lifting bolts and remove the cab lift bolts.
23. Re-install the tractor seat.
24. Re-install the left and right cab doors.
25. Route the electrical harness into the hood area. Tie down as necessary to prevent
interference with moving components.
26. Connect the black 10GA wire to the tractor ground with the provided 1/4" loop connector.
Shorten wire if necessary, then solder connector directly onto wire.
27. Connect the red 10GA wire to a 12V power source on the starter with the provided 1/4"
loop connector. Shorten wire if necessary, then solder connector to wire.
28. Connect the orange wire to a switched 12V source on the alternator. Verify with test light,
then solder wire directly to the tractor wire. This wire powers a relay which when activated will
provide power to the cab.
29. Take the floor mat provided and place it into the operator platform. With the push buttons
provided, snap the floor mat into place. Left side shown only. Repeat for right side.
